This article delves into the nuances of selecting the appropriate size for mixing equipment, exploring its implications on productivity, cost, and overall operational success.<\/p>\n<h2 id=\"the-importance-of-sizing-in-industrial-mixing-UYHWQxbifV\">The Importance of Sizing in Industrial Mixing<\/h2>\n<p>Choosing the correct size for industrial mixing equipment is not merely a matter of convenience; it directly impacts the quality of the final product and the efficiency of the mixing process. **Under-sized equipment** can lead to inadequate mixing, resulting in inconsistent product quality, while **over-sized equipment** can waste energy and resources. Understanding the specific requirements of your mixing process is essential for optimizing performance.<\/p>\n<h3 id=\"key-factors-influencing-equipment-size-UYHWQxbifV\">Key Factors Influencing Equipment Size<\/h3>\n<p>Several factors must be considered when determining the appropriate size for industrial mixing equipment:<\/p>\n<ul>\n<li><strong>Batch Size:<\/strong> The volume of material to be mixed is a primary determinant of equipment size. Larger batch sizes typically require larger mixers to ensure uniformity.<\/li>\n<li><strong>Viscosity of Materials:<\/strong> The thickness of the materials being mixed affects how well they can be blended. High-viscosity materials may require specialized equipment that can handle their density.<\/li>\n<li><strong>Mixing Time:<\/strong> The desired mixing time can influence the size of the equipment. Shorter mixing times may necessitate larger or more powerful mixers to achieve the desired consistency quickly.<\/li>\n<li><strong>Type of Mixing Process:<\/strong> Different processes, such as batch mixing versus continuous mixing, have distinct size requirements based on their operational methodologies.<\/li>\n<\/ul>\n<h2 id=\"industry-trends-and-data-insights-UYHWQxbifV\">Industry Trends and Data Insights<\/h2>\n<p>Recent industry reports indicate a growing trend towards **automation and smart technology** in mixing equipment, which can also influence size considerations.
